Ellen Mattson

Ellen Mattson (born 1962) lives on the Swedish West coast. She has published eight novels – the first in 1992 – and received much acclaim from the critics and several prestigious literary prizes. In 1998 Ellen Mattson was awarded the Svenska Dagbladet’s Literary Prize for her novel The Travelers. In 2011 Ellen Mattson was awarded the prestigious Selma Lagerlöf’s prize.
